What is the difference between the following syntax:
model(10).results = fitlm(tbl,'Acceleration ~ id * Weight');
and
model(10).results = fitlm(tbl,'Acceleration ~ id + Weight');
I am trying to run a linear model but allowing the intercept to vary per the "id" or identity of each observation.

id + Weight includes both id and Weight as linear terms, it appears.
id * Weight includes id, Weight, and id times Weight terms, if I understand correctly.
